如何实现Java IO异常产生原因

1. 流程概述

为了帮助你理解Java IO异常产生的原因,我将会通过以下步骤来详细解释:

journey
    title Java IO异常产生原因实现流程
    section 理解Java IO异常产生原因
        开始 --> 创建文件对象 --> 打开文件 --> 读写文件 --> 关闭文件 --> 结束

2. 步骤解释

2.1 创建文件对象

首先,我们需要创建一个文件对象来操作文件。在Java中,可以使用File类来表示文件对象。下面的代码演示了如何创建一个文件对象:

// 引用形式的描述信息:创建文件对象
File file = new File("example.txt");

2.2 打开文件

接下来,我们需要打开文件以便进行读写操作。可以使用FileInputStreamFileOutputStream来打开文件。以下是打开文件的示例代码:

// 引用形式的描述信息:打开文件
FileInputStream fis = new FileInputStream(file);

2.3 读写文件

在打开文件之后,我们可以通过输入流或输出流进行文件读写操作。以下是一个读取文件内容的示例代码:

// 引用形式的描述信息:读写文件
int data = fis.read();
while(data != -1) {
    System.out.print((char)data);
    data = fis.read();
}

2.4 关闭文件

最后,在完成文件操作后,必须关闭文件以释放资源。以下是关闭文件的示例代码:

// 引用形式的描述信息:关闭文件
fis.close();

结论

通过以上步骤,你应该已经掌握了Java IO异常产生的原因。记住,在处理文件时,一定要注意异常处理,以避免程序崩溃或数据丢失的情况发生。希望这篇文章对你有所帮助!